Ive had an led P7, good little torch, not powerful enough for lamping though, I also have had one of these for about a year http://dx.com/p/trustfire-x8-xm-lt60-5-mode-1000-lumen-memory-white-led-fla

ive been having a play with a trustfire, the light it throws out is more than adequate to lamp with although ive made a few modifications today to try to tighten the beam up a little, as for battery life i would think its short lived but as i say im still playing about with it, although it does come with rechargable batteries and a charger, so i might just invest in another couple of sets of batteries. perfect for a short walk about where a traditional lamp would be a hindrance :whistling:

I have just bought a 1800 lumen zoomable on the bay from china about £13 comes with two batterys and charger its got the T6 light chip, Roy Lupton just reviewed a simaler model on fieldsports channel but his costs £150 the one I got has a higher output, fits in your pocket a treat zooms into a nice bright square of light much better than a lot of sh*t they are trying to sell over here.
